We are currently looking for a Project Development Manager to join our Metlen team in Canada.

 

As part of METLEN’s North American Development team, you will play a key role in advancing utility-scale Solar PV, BESS and other renewable energy projects across Canada. Working closely with the Country Manager and senior development leadership, you will be responsible for driving projects throughout the development lifecycle, from origination and site control through permitting, interconnection, stakeholder engagement and readiness for construction.

 

The successful candidate will combine strong project development expertise, commercial awareness and stakeholder management capabilities to support the continued growth of METLEN’s renewable energy platform in one of its priority markets.

 

 

 

YOUR ROLE WILL ENCOMPASS:

 

 

• Leading utility-scale Solar PV, BESS and renewable energy projects throughout the development lifecycle across Canada.

• Driving project advancement from origination and site control through permitting, interconnection, stakeholder engagement and readiness for construction.

• Managing relationships with landowners, Indigenous communities, municipalities, utilities, regulatory authorities and other key stakeholders.

• Coordinating environmental, permitting, interconnection and technical workstreams to ensure timely project progression.

• Supporting the identification, assessment and execution of greenfield, co-development and acquisition opportunities.

• Conducting project due diligence and supporting investment decisions through commercial, technical and regulatory assessments.

• Managing external consultants, development partners and advisors, ensuring deliverables are completed on schedule and within budget.

• Collaborating closely with Engineering, EPC, Legal, Finance, PPA & Origination, Project Finance and Asset Management teams throughout the project lifecycle.

• Identifying project risks, developing mitigation strategies and implementing corrective actions where required.

• Preparing development updates, project presentations, investment recommendations and supporting senior management decision-making processes.

• Monitoring market developments, regulatory changes and competitive activity within the Canadian renewable energy sector and identifying opportunities for portfolio growth.

• Supporting project handovers from Development to EPC and Construction teams, ensuring continuity and effective stakeholder alignment.
